Lemongrass SHIITAKE noodle salad

Fragrant lemongrass marinated pulled shiitake takes center stage in this Vietnamese-inspired noodle salad, paired with a zingy nuoc cham dressing

Makes 10-12 portions

Prep time: 20 mins | Cook time: 10 mins

INGREDIENTS

2.2lb (1kg) bag of Fable Pulled Shiitake Mushrooms, thawed

For lemongrass marinade:

1 cup oyster sauce

¼ cup tamari (soy sauce)

¼ cup sesame oil

¼ cup lemon juice

4 tsp maple syrup or sugar

4 stalks of fresh lemongrass (white part)

4 brown onions, cut in half, thinly sliced lengthwise

12 garlic cloves, minced

Nuoc cham dressing:

½ cup warm water

2 tbsp sugar

¼ cup fish sauce

¼ cup white or rice vinegar 

2 tbsp lime juice

1 minced chili

To serve (1 bowl):

90g lemongrass Fable protein

50g Vermicelli rice noodles

70-80g shredded lettuce

Handful mint and cilantro (coriander), finely chopped

50g cucumber, julienned 

Handful bean sprouts 

Optional garnishes:

Chopped roasted peanuts

Fried shallots

Sliced fresh chili

METHOD

To make nuoc cham dressing, combine the sugar and warm water until dissolved. Then add the remaining ingredients and whisk together.

Bash lemongrass stalks with a pestle or rolling pin, then roughly chop. In a food processor, whiz the lemongrass into fine shreds. In a large mixing bowl, combine all the wet ingredients for the lemongrass marinade and stir until well combined. Add onion, minced garlic and lemongrass.

Shred Fable into smaller bits and add them into the wet mixture. Combine and ensure Fable is evenly coated. Heat oil in a large pan until hot and add Fable mixture, and fry for about 10 mins until onion and Fable are nicely browned.

To serve:

Cook vermicelli noodles according to their pack instructions, rise with cold water and strain. For each bowl, combine shredded lettuce and chopped Asian herbs. Then layer with noodles, pickled carrot and daikon, cucumber sticks, fried lemongrass Fable and bean sprouts. 

Top with peanuts, fried shallots, chili slices and extra Asian herbs. Portion 2 heaping tbsps of nuoc cham dressing and serve on the side.

Tips & suggestions:

  • Batch make the nuoc cham dressing and store for up to 7 days.

  • Lemongrass Fable protein can be used across several formats - rice bowls, Banh Mi or even a salad without the noodles.

  • If your kitchen has a hot wok or skillet, we definitely recommend this to amplify the caramelization and char of the Fable.
